
When Vogue Italia editor Franca Sozzani announced her decision to create an all-black issue, she recognized that it might not go over that well in Italy."Maybe in our country it is not the best idea," she said. "But I don't care. I think it is not my problem if they don't like it — it's their problem." It's definitely not a problem at all. Even if it's the lowest-selling Vogue Italia of the year in Italy (although there's no indication that it is), it is certainly the best-selling Vogue Italia issue in the States. This explains why every one I've gone into for the past week has been sold out of them.
Tracking the issue down was a journey in itself. Even in New York City, the few newsstands that carried the issue sold out within hours (one newsstand went through 400 copies). There were waiting lists and prepaid orders. Many of the customers, according to newsstand staffers I talked to, bought all four versions with different covers as keepsakes. At $16 a copy (one newsstand wanted to charge me $20 to prepay for one from his next batch), it was a circulation director's fantasy come true.
One wonders if the incredible success of this issue will inspire copycats. Although, the most brilliant outcome would be that editors finally realize that when you put black women in magazines, even if it's not only black women, more black women will buy them and white women won't stop buying them. Diversity isn't bad for the fashion business. [AdAge]
